Elements and Performance Criteria
- Contribute to writing of policy and procedures for an evacuation situation.
- Applicable provisions of legislative and organisational requirements relevant to planning and conducting evacuations are identified and complied with.
- Occupational Health and Safety (OHS) requirements for evacuation procedures are obtained and reviewed.
- Emergency scenarios are discussed and a system of emergency alerting determined in consultation with relevant persons.
- Evacuation policy incorporates outcomes of the consultative process and is presented for review to relevant persons.
- Presented information uses clear and concise language and complies with organisational requirements for format, style and structure.
- Industry information is regularly reviewed to establish the need for new or revised evacuation policy and procedures.
- Participate in conducting evacuation drills.
- Documented evacuation policy and procedures are disseminated to relevant persons in accordance with organisational procedures.
- Further information and support materials are readily available and accessible.
- Routine and regular evacuation drills are planned and scheduled in consultation with relevant persons.
- Fire wardens are identified and confirmed in strategic locations.
- Evacuation drills are conducted in accordance with evacuation policy and procedures.
- Feedback on evacuation implementation is sought and modifications to evacuation policy and procedures are finalised and reissued in a timely manner.
- Conduct evacuation.
- Evacuation need is determined and appropriate emergency services agencies are notified.
- Hazards are identified and appropriate risk control measures are implemented within scope of own responsibility, competency and authority.
- Evacuation of premises is conducted in accordance with evacuation policy and procedures.
- Mobility impaired persons are identified and special arrangements implemented in accordance with organisational procedures.
- Evacuated personnel are accounted for in accordance with evacuation policy and procedures.
- Relevant documentation is completed and securely maintained in accordance organisational procedures.
